While Steemit defines itself as a Social Blogging Site, I think that a lot of problems come from treating it differently than a Social Media Site like Facebook or acting as if content HAS to be a certain way. The main problem, in my humble opinion, is that it wastes everyone's time. So many write these long posts which could have been just as informative in a few sentences or a single paragraph just so they can argue that they 'put a lot of effort' into it. I personally don't think value comes from length of post; it comes from how the post resonates with people. In fact, I think that brevity can be even more admirable. Those are my thoughts right now. Empower yourself on Steemit by evolving out of the imagined RULES. I've been on here a year and I want to see growth. If 'likes' are meant to be value, then let people like what they want. If they like a post that is a single meme, all the power to them. Maybe you should start memeing. Rock on and Steem on!
